Event:
From 1100 to 1800 hours on Tuesday, January 10, Ataka, a Bulgarian nationalist political party, plans to protest the anniversary of allied forces bombings in Sofia during World War II.
Demonstration organizers notified the embassy of a demonstration in front of the U.S. embassy in Sofia, consisting of approximately 60-70 demonstrators. The Embassy does not anticipate disruptions to routine consular services.
